Important Materials
The stuff your cooler is made of matters a lot.
Outer Shell
Most good coolers have a tough plastic outer shell. High-density polyethylene (HDPE) is a common and strong material. This protects your cooler from dents and damage.
Insulation
The inside of the cooler is filled with insulation. This is what keeps the cold in. Many 2021 models use thick polyurethane foam. The thicker the insulation, the better it works.
Lining
The inside lining should be smooth and easy to clean. It’s often made of food-grade plastic. This makes sure your food stays safe and the cooler doesn’t get smelly.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Certain things make a cooler better or worse.
Thick Walls and Good Seals
Coolers with thicker walls and a good seal around the lid keep cold air in and warm air out. This is a big deal for how long your ice lasts.
UV Protection
Some coolers have UV protection. This stops the sun from making the plastic brittle and cracking over time. This helps your cooler last longer, especially if you use it outdoors a lot.
Cheap Latches and Hinges
Poorly made latches can be hard to open and close. They can also break. The same goes for hinges. Good quality latches and hinges make the cooler easier to use and last longer.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What is the main advantage of a 20-quart cooler?
A: The main advantage is its balanced size. It’s big enough for essentials but still easy to carry.
Q: How many drinks can a 20-quart cooler hold?
A: A 20-quart cooler can typically hold about 24 cans of soda, plus ice.
Q: How long will ice last in a 2021 model 20-quart cooler?
A: Good 2021 models can keep ice frozen for 3 to 5 days, depending on the weather and how often you open it.
Q: Are 20-quart coolers good for long trips?
A: For trips longer than a weekend, you might need a larger cooler. But for day trips or weekend adventures, they are great.
Q: What makes a cooler’s insulation better?
A: Thicker insulation, like polyurethane foam, and fewer gaps between the walls and the lid help keep the cold in better.
Q: Can I put food directly into the cooler?
A: Yes, if the lining is food-grade plastic. However, it’s often best to pack food in containers or bags to keep it extra clean and dry.
Q: How should I clean my cooler?
A: Wash it with mild soap and warm water. Make sure to rinse it well and let it air dry completely before storing.
Q: Do I need to pre-chill my cooler?
A: Yes, pre-chilling your cooler by putting ice or frozen water bottles inside for a few hours before you pack it helps it stay cold longer.
